Activity.Name Özellik

Tanım

Bu örneğin adını alır veya ayarlar. Bu ad, İş Akışı projesinde kullanılan programlama dilinin değişken adlandırma kuralına uygun olmalıdır.

C#
[System.ComponentModel.Browsable(true)]
public string Name { get; set; }

Özellik Değeri

String

Bu örneğin adı.

Öznitelikler

Örnekler

Aşağıdaki kodda etkinliklerin nasıl oluşturulacağı ve bunların bileşik etkinliğe nasıl alt öğe olarak ekleneceği ve değerinin Namenasıl ayarlanacağı gösterilmektedir.

Bu kod örneği Throw SDK örneğinin bir parçasıdır ve ThrowWorkFlow.cs dosyasındandır. Daha fazla bilgi için bkz . Throw Sample.

C#
this.CanModifyActivities = true;
System.Workflow.ComponentModel.ActivityBind activitybind1 = new System.Workflow.ComponentModel.ActivityBind();
this.throwActivity1 = new System.Workflow.ComponentModel.ThrowActivity();
activitybind1.Name = "ThrowWorkflow";
activitybind1.Path = "ThrownException";
//
// throwActivity1
//
this.throwActivity1.Name = "throwActivity1";
this.throwActivity1.SetBinding(System.Workflow.ComponentModel.ThrowActivity.FaultProperty, ((System.Workflow.ComponentModel.ActivityBind)(activitybind1)));
//
// ThrowWorkflow
//
this.Activities.Add(this.throwActivity1);
this.Name = "ThrowWorkflow";
this.CanModifyActivities = false;

Açıklamalar

Bunun varsayılan değeri boş dizedir.

Bu özellik meta bir özelliktir ve bu da çalışma zamanında değiştirilemeyeceği anlamına gelir. Meta özellikler çalışma zamanında bir özellik örneği oluşturulduktan sonra değişmez, bu nedenle özellik tasarım zamanında değişmez değere ayarlanmalıdır.

Şunlara uygulanır

Ürün Sürümler
.NET Framework 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8